christopher provided civil engineering, surveying and landscape architecture services to develop a 104-acre site along Sycolin Road into a 500,000 SF data center campus with 75 megawatt of critical IT capacity.
christopher has supported the project from the initial planning stages, including rezoning support, site evaluation, preparation of permits and plats, cost estimating, and preparation of preliminary and construction plans. Full site surveying services as well as construction administration services are also being provided. The site had to be designed to avoid environmental constraints including FEMA floodplain, river and stream buffers, shallow rocks and wetlands.
Landscape architecture efforts included preparation of landscape planting plans for this project. Our team overcame challenges such as various onsite environmental protection zones due to the adjacent Goose Creek and screening the data center from Sycolin Road to preserve its scenic views.
